Teaching

Informations on the Artificial Intelligence and Machine Learning (IAAA) track of the computer science at AMU.

Web Programming

  • 2012-2015 (30 hours)
  • Aix-Marseille Université
  • BSc level (L2)
  • javascript, node.js, html5

Language theory

  • 2011-2015 (50 hours)
  • Aix-Marseille Université
  • BSc level (L2)
  • Finite State Automata and regular languages

Programming methodology

  • 2011-2014 (38 hours)
  • Aix-Marseille Université
  • MSc level (M2)
  • UML Diagrams, Design patterns, Methodology

C programming

  • 2010-2015 (264 hours)
  • Aix-Marseille Université
  • BSc level (L1)
  • Data structures, pointers, linked lists, sorting algorithms

Past classes

Natural Language Processing

  • 2010-2015 (135 hours)
  • Aix-Marseille Université
  • MSc level (M1)
  • Statistical methods, methodology and evaluation, machine Learning, tagging, machine translation, summarization

Computer tools

  • 2010-2011, 2014 (30 hours)
  • Aix-Marseille Université
  • BSc level (L1)
  • Word processing, speardsheets, presentations, latex, bash, preparation for C2i

XML

  • 2010-2011 (33 hours)
  • Aix-Marseille Université
  • Msc level (M1)
  • DTD, schemas, stylesheets, java API

Data compression

  • 2005-2006 (16 hours)
  • University of Avignon
  • MSc level (M2)
  • Ultra-low bandwidth speech compression using a phoneme decoder and speech synthesis

Networking

  • 2003-2004 (80 hours)
  • University of Avignon
  • BSc level (L3)
  • Tutorials: RJ45 cables, network traffic analysis, CISCO routers

Office computing tutorials

  • 2000 (60 hours)
  • University of Avignon
  • BSc level (L1)
  • MS Office tutorials for biology and literature students.

Last updated on 2018-07-13